Introduction to the Teamgroup MP44L

The Teamgroup MP44L is a NVMe M.2 SSD designed for high-speed data transfer and reliability. It features the PCIe Gen3 x4 interface, making it suitable for gaming, content creation, and professional workloads. With capacities ranging from 256GB to 1TB, it offers flexibility for various user needs.

Test Setup and Methodology

Performance testing was conducted using a standard desktop setup with an AMD Ryzen 7 processor and an ASUS motherboard supporting PCIe 3.0. The tests included sequential read/write, random IOPS, and real-world file transfer scenarios. Benchmark tools such as CrystalDiskMark and AS SSD were employed to ensure accuracy.

Sequential Read and Write Performance

The MP44L demonstrated sequential read speeds of up to 3,200 MB/s and write speeds of approximately 2,800 MB/s. These figures are consistent with manufacturer claims and indicate strong performance for large file transfers and streaming applications.

Random IOPS Performance

In random read/write tests, the SSD achieved around 400,000 IOPS for 4K read and write operations. This level of performance ensures smooth multitasking and quick access to small files, which is essential for professional workflows and gaming.

Real-World Scenario Testing

Beyond synthetic benchmarks, real-world testing provides practical insights. The following scenarios simulate typical user activities:

  • Game Load Times: Loading popular AAA titles was noticeably faster compared to traditional SATA SSDs, with load times reduced by approximately 20%.
  • Video Editing: Transferring large 4K video files was swift, with sustained transfer rates around 2.9 GB/s, facilitating efficient editing workflows.
  • Multitasking: Running multiple applications and simultaneous file transfers showed minimal lag, demonstrating the SSD’s capability to handle demanding tasks.

Durability and Reliability

The MP44L features 1,500 TBW (Terabytes Written) for the 1TB model, indicating good endurance for typical usage. During testing, the drive maintained stable performance without thermal throttling or errors, underscoring its reliability.
